> I've been scouring the archives regarding Mailman and virtual domains, but
> can't get it to work. My setup: Mailman 2.0.7, postfix, Linux-Mandrake 8.1.
> 
> What I did (following Jon Carnes instructions):
> 
> Created new list
> Added aliases to /etc/postfix/aliases, ran newaliases
> Edited /etc/postfix/virtual to reflect:
> myvirtual.com virtual
> test at myvirtual.com test
> test-request at myvirtual.com test-request (and so on for the other aliases)
> 
> Ran postmap /etc/postfix/virtual
> Stopped and started postfix.
> 
> Went to Web admin, changed Host name this list prefers and Alias names
> (regexps).
> 
> When I attempt to subscribe via the web I get the subscription message which
> comes from test-request at myvirtual.com, but when I reply to confirm, I get a
> postfix user not found error, and it says test-request at myrealdomain.com is the
> address that can't be found.
> 
> What am I doing wrong?
